Can a 1500W Inverter Power a Food Truck?
👉 Short answer: Yes — but only for light-duty equipment
Suitable for:
- POS systems
- LED lighting
- Small appliances
- Phone/laptop charging

Equipment Compatibility
| Equipment | Power (W) | Suitable? |
|---|---|---|
| POS System | 50–100W | ✅ Yes |
| LED Lighting | 50–200W | ✅ Yes |
| Blender | 300–600W | ⚠️ Limited |
| Small Fridge | 150–300W | ✅ Yes |
| Grill / Heater | 1500W+ | ❌ No |
👉 Important: Cooking equipment usually exceeds 1500W capacity.
When is 1500W Enough for a Food Truck?
A 1500W inverter works if:
- You operate a light-duty food setup
- You use pre-prepared or low-power equipment
- Power demand is intermittent
When You Need More Power
You should consider higher capacity if:
- Running heating equipment
- Using multiple appliances
- Operating full kitchen setups
